π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

13 items
  • 250 grams macaroni pasta
  • 300 grams cauliflower florets
  • 50 grams butter
  • 50 grams all-purpose flour
  • 500 milliliters milk
  • 200 grams sharp cheddar cheese, grated
  • 50 grams par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1 teaspoon mustard pow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 50 grams panko breadcrumbs
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

πŸ“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 200Β°C (400Β°F).

2

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the macaroni pasta according to the package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.

3

In the same pot, add the cauliflower florets and boil for 4-5 minutes until just tender. Drain and set aside.

4

In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Stir in the flour and cook for 1-2 minutes, whisking constantly, to form a roux.

5

Slowly add the milk to the roux, whisking constantly to ensure there are no lumps. Cook for 5-7 minutes, stirring frequently, until the sauce thickens.

6

Remove the sauce from the heat and stir in the grated cheddar cheese, parmesan cheese, mustard powder, paprika, salt, and black pepper until smooth.

7

Combine the cooked macaroni and cauliflower in a large mixing bowl. Pour the cheese sauce over the mixture and stir until evenly coated.

8

Transfer the macaroni and cauliflower mixture to a greased baking dish, spreading it out evenly.

9

In a small bowl, mix the panko breadcrumbs with the olive oil. Sprinkle the breadcrumb mixture evenly over the top of the macaroni and cauliflower.

10

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and crispy.

11

Allow the bake to cool for 5 minutes before serving. Enjoy!

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(372.2g)
Calories
797
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 39.5 g 51%
Saturated Fat 23.1 g 115%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 106 mg 35%
Sodium 1273 mg 55%
Total Carbohydrate 78.5 g 29%
Dietary Fiber 4.8 g 17%
Total Sugars 10.4 g
Protein 34.2 g 68%
Vitamin D 2.1 mcg 10%
Calcium 686 mg 53%
Iron 2.6 mg 14%
Potassium 571 mg 12%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
